Для студентов МГИМО по предмету Любой или несколько предметовПроектирование и разработка программного расширения продукта Belkasoft X для исполнения скриптов на языке PythonПроектирование и разработка программного расширения продукта Belkasoft X для исполнения скриптов на языке Python
4,9551043
2024-08-012024-08-01СтудИзба
Курсовая работа: Проектирование и разработка программного расширения продукта Belkasoft X для исполнения скриптов на языке Python
Описание
языке Python
Оглавление
2
Введение
Цифровая криминалистика – это отрасль криминалистики, которая занимается анализом цифровых устройств для расследования преступ-лений. Цифровая криминалистика использует специализированные ин-струменты, технологии и методы для анализа данных, хранящихся на компьютерах, смартфонах, планшетах, смарт-часах и других цифровые устройствах, а также для восстановления информации, которая может быть использована в расследованиях.
Одной из важных задач цифровой криминалистики является извле-чение и анализ артефактов и их метаданных. Артефакт – это цифровой след, оставленный на цифровом устройстве, который может быть ис-пользован в судебных или следственных процессах для установления фактов. К таким артефактам относятся истории звонков и переписок в мессенджерах, почтовые сообщения, кэш браузера, записи из реестра, аудио файлы, данные геолокации и многое другое.
Компания «Цифровая Корпоративная Защита» занимается разра-боткой инструмента Belkasoft X, предназначенного для извлечения, вос-становления и анализа данных. Одной из задач этого инструмента яв-ляется анализ данных с различных устройств и приложений. Продукт реализован преимущественно на языке C#. Для анализа данных до-ступен список анализаторов – компонентов
Оглавление
| Введение | 3 | ||
| 1. | Постановка задачи | 5 | |
| 2. | Обзор | 6 | |
| 2.1. | Анализаторы в Belkasoft X . . . . . . . . . . . . . . . . . . | 6 | |
| 2.2. | Интеграция Python и C# кода . . . . . . . . . . . . . . . | 6 | |
| 2.2.1. Выборинструмента . . . . . . . . . . . . . . . . . . | 6 | ||
| 2.2.2. PythonNet . . . . . . . . . . . . . . . . . . . . . . . | 7 | ||
| 3. | Реализация | 9 | |
| 3.1. | Архитектура.......................... | 9 | |
| 3.2. | Python-скрипт . . . . . . . . . . . . . . . . . . . . . . . . . | 10 | |
| 3.3. | Вспомогательная Python-библиотека . . . . . . . . . . . . | 10 | |
| 4. | Заключение | 12 | |
| Список литературы | 13 | ||
2
Введение
- современном мире невозможно представить себе жизнь без ком-пьютеров и мобильных устройств. Поэтому данные, хранящиеся на них, важны правоохранительным органам для раскрытия и предотвраще-ния различных преступлений. В исследовании этих устройств помогает цифровая криминалистика.
Цифровая криминалистика – это отрасль криминалистики, которая занимается анализом цифровых устройств для расследования преступ-лений. Цифровая криминалистика использует специализированные ин-струменты, технологии и методы для анализа данных, хранящихся на компьютерах, смартфонах, планшетах, смарт-часах и других цифровые устройствах, а также для восстановления информации, которая может быть использована в расследованиях.
Одной из важных задач цифровой криминалистики является извле-чение и анализ артефактов и их метаданных. Артефакт – это цифровой след, оставленный на цифровом устройстве, который может быть ис-пользован в судебных или следственных процессах для установления фактов. К таким артефактам относятся истории звонков и переписок в мессенджерах, почтовые сообщения, кэш браузера, записи из реестра, аудио файлы, данные геолокации и многое другое.
Компания «Цифровая Корпоративная Защита» занимается разра-боткой инструмента Belkasoft X, предназначенного для извлечения, вос-становления и анализа данных. Одной из задач этого инструмента яв-ляется анализ данных с различных устройств и приложений. Продукт реализован преимущественно на языке C#. Для анализа данных до-ступен список анализаторов – компонентов
Характеристики курсовой работы
Учебное заведение
Семестр
Просмотров
1
Размер
196 Kb
Список файлов
Проектирование и разработка программного расширения продукта Belkasoft X для исполнения скриптов на языке Python.doc
Комментарии
Нет комментариев
Стань первым, кто что-нибудь напишет!
МГИМО
Tortuga
















